FIGURE 1. Biosynthesis of PEB and PCB. PEB biosynthesis proceeds via two different pathways. PebA and PebB catalyze consecutive two-electron reductions of BV and 15,16-DHBV to yield PEB. PebS catalyzes the four-electron reduction of BV to PEB via the two-electron reduced intermediate 15,16-DHBV. PcyA catalyzes a four-electron reduction of biliverdin IX to PCB via the intermediate 18^1,18^2-DHBV. The electrons for all reactions come from reduced [2Fe-2S] ferredoxin (Fd[red]). The carbons of the respective reduction sites are numbered. Fd[ox], oxidized ferredoxin; P, propionate side chain.
